Lowcountry animal shelters offering reduced-fee adoptions
CHARLESTON, S.C. (WCSC) - Three Lowcountry animal shelters are participating in a national drive to reduce overcrowding at shelters and find homes for homeless pets. Berkeley Animal Center, the Charleston Animal Society and Dorchester Paws will be participating in the Bissell Pet Foundation’s “Summer National Empty the Shelters” event from July 8-31. All pets available for adoption at the “Summer National Empty the Shelters” event are microchipped, vaccinated and fixed and are adoptable for $50 or less.

Richland County shooting leaves two men wounded; victims say they were leaving a party
RICHLAND COUNTY, S.C. — Authorities say two men were wounded in an overnight shooting in Richland County. According to the Richland County Sheriff's Department, the victims arrived by private vehicle at an area hospital just before midnight. They told investigators they were shot while leaving a party in the area of S.C. 277 and Fontaine Road and that they were already on the highway at the time.

Gonzalez Celebrates Birthday by Walking Off Pelicans in 10th Inning; RiverDogs Sweep Series
Charleston, SC - Ricardo Gonzalez turned 20 years old on Saturday. The Charleston RiverDogs shortstop celebrated by grounding a base hit through the left side of the infield that plated the winning run in a wild 11-10 extra-inning affair at Joseph P. Riley, Jr. Park. The RiverDogs set a new franchise record by stealing 13 bases in the game without being caught. The six-game sweep was the team’s first since June of 2022. 5,638 fans took in the high-scoring contest.
